Bollywood legend to gain India highest award

Legendary Bollywood star is set to receive India’s highest film honor.

Legendary Bollywood star Amitabh Bachchan is set to receive India’s highest film honor.

The iconic figure in India cinema will be honored with the Dadasaheb Phalke Award, the country’s  Information and Broadcasting Minister Prakash Javadekar announced in the social media.

"The legend Amitabh Bachchan, who entertained and inspired for two generations, has been selected unanimously for Dadasaheb Phalke Award. The entire country and international community is happy. My heartiest congratulations to him," the post reads.

The award will be presented to the actor in New Dehhi during a national awards ceremony at a date yet to be confirmed.

Bachchan celebrates his 50th year in cinema this year, following his 1969 debut. His filmography includes more 200 films with his 70s and 80s works representing the peak of his acting career.

This is not his first notable honor as Bachchan received France's highest civilian honor, the Knight of the Legion of Honor in 2007.
